British Prime Minister Keir Starmer has announced a forthcoming ban on social media access for individuals under the age of 16. While acknowledging the benefits social media can offer, Starmer framed the decision as a necessary choice for the government, prioritizing youth wellbeing. Details regarding the implementation of the ban, including enforcement mechanisms, have not yet been fully outlined. The Prime Minister indicated the decision was not taken lightly and recognizes potential drawbacks. This policy shift aims to address growing concerns about the impact of social media on young people’s mental health and online safety. The move signals a significant intervention by the UK government into the digital lives of its citizens. Further details are expected as the legislation progresses.
